   STUDENTS' PERCEPTION ABOUT THE CLINICO-ANATOMICAL CONFERENCES AS A TEACHING METHODOLOGY

چکیده    Background: anatomy has always been considered as an essential basis for clinical sciences. in recent decades there has been an increased trend towards incorporation of clinical problems in the teaching of anatomy. to promote clinical knowledge clinico-anatomical conferences have been conducted in our department for the last five years. this study has been undertaken to determine perception of medical students regarding these conferences and to formulate recommendations for their improvement based on feedback obtained from students.method: a cross-sectional study was conducted from december 2013 to january 2014 at the lahore medical & dental college (lmdc),lahore. a sample of 200 students of first and second year mbbs classes was selected for the study through convenience sampling technique. a 5-point likert scale ranging from 1 (strongly agree) to 5 (strongly disagree) was used to determine students' perception about clinic-anatomical conferences,using a self-administered questionnaire. data was analysed using spss-19.0.results: out of total 144 (72%) students were of the opinion that clinico-anatomical conferences were a good source of clinical knowledge,126 (63%) opined that these conferences promoted understanding rather than memorization,122 (61%) found them interesting,and 15 (30%) found improvement in their grades in the subject of anatomy after attending the conferences.conclusion: the clinico-anatomical conferences were found interesting and reported to be a good source of clinical knowledge. it is recommended that these conferences should be conducted frequently,made interactive and patients should be presented as case studies during the conferences
